Android app development is increasingly becoming a crucial element for businesses worldwide. With billions of Android users globally, the demand for mobile apps is at an all-time high. This has created a massive opportunity for businesses to expand their reach and tap into a vast audience by investing in Android app development. However, with so many companies offering Android app development services, it can be challenging for businesses to select the right partner. Finding a reliable Android app development company that understands your business needs and can deliver high-quality apps is essential. It can help you achieve your business goals, attract new customers, and drive growth.

Here at TechnBrains, we've been at the forefront of Android app development for over a decade. Our team of skilled developers crafts innovative and user-centric apps that deliver exceptional results. But we understand that every project has unique needs, so we've compiled a list of the top 10 Android app development companies in 2024 to help you find the perfect fit.

Selection Criteria

To create this comprehensive list, we considered several factors:

       Expertise: Proven track record of developing high-quality, successful Android apps.

       Experience: Years of experience in the Android app development industry.

       Client Satisfaction: Positive client reviews and testimonials.

       Services Offered: Range of services, including app strategy, design, development, and deployment.

       Industry Recognition: Awards and recognition within the Android development community.

Top 10 Android App Development Companies in 2024

Here's a detailed breakdown of the top 10 Android app development companies in 2024:

1.     TechnBrains


Founded: 2013


Clutch Rating: 4.6

TechnBrains brings over a decade of experience to the table. We specialize in crafting custom Android apps that align perfectly with your business goals. We take pride in our collaborative approach, ensuring clear communication and exceeding client expectations throughout the development process. We are recognized as the best Android app development company by Clutch and GoodFirms.

2.     The NineHertz


This company is renowned for its innovative solutions and comprehensive Android app development services. They offer expertise in native, hybrid, and cross-platform app development, ensuring a seamless user experience.

3.     ScienceSoft


A leader in Android app development, ScienceSoft offers custom mobile apps and utility development. They excel at integrating developed apps with backend corporate systems and web services, providing a holistic mobile solution.

4.     Andersen Inc.


Established as a leader in the app development industry, Andersen Inc. focuses on cutting-edge technologies and custom software development. Their team of experts can create robust and scalable Android apps for businesses of all sizes.

5.     Saritasa


Known for its comprehensive technology solutions, Saritasa seamlessly integrates the latest innovations across various platforms. Their Android app development services encompass the entire development lifecycle, from ideation to deployment and ongoing maintenance.


6.     Merixstudio


This company specializes in agile development, creating user-centric mobile apps that drive engagement and business growth. Their focus on agile methodologies ensures a flexible and adaptable development process, allowing for quick iterations and adjustments based on user feedback.


7.     Kellton Tech


A pioneer in AI and ML services, Kellton Tech also provides advanced Android development services. With a team of over 1800 digital and tech experts, they cater to businesses across various industries, delivering innovative and secure Android apps.


8.     Konstant Infosolutions


 A trusted mobile app and web development company, Konstant Infosolutions has a proven track record of developing world-class applications for diverse industry niches. Their focus is on exceeding customer satisfaction and adapting to evolving technological trends.


9.     Cumulations Technologies:


This company is a leader in Enterprise Mobile Applications Development. Their expertise lies in building robust Android and iOS applications supported by a strong cloud-based backend infrastructure. Cumulations Technologies caters to various sectors, including healthcare, entertainment, and IoT.


10.  Prismetric


Delivering high-quality products and premium services, Prismetric is another top contender in the Android app development landscape. They offer a comprehensive range of services, from app strategy to development and deployment.

Choosing the Right Android App Development Company

The ideal Android app development company for your project will depend on your specific needs and budget. Consider the following factors when making your selection:

       Project Scope and Complexity: The complexity of your app will influence the development team's experience level required.

       Industry Expertise: Does the company have experience developing apps in your specific industry?

       Development Methodology: Agile vs. Waterfall development approaches cater to different project needs.

       Communication and Transparency: Clear communication throughout the development process is vital for a successful outcome.

       Client Reviews and Portfolio: Research the company's past projects and client testimonials to gauge their capabilities.

By carefully considering these factors alongside the information provided in this blog, you can make an informed decision and select the best Android app development company to bring your mobile vision to life.

Tips for a Successful Android App Development Project

Crafting a successful Android app takes more than just a great idea. Here are some key tips to guide you through the development process and ensure your app thrives in the Play Store:

1. Define Your App Idea Clearly:

       Identify a Need: Before diving into development, clearly define the problem your app solves or the need it fulfills. Conduct market research to ensure your concept has a target audience and isn't already saturated in the Play Store.

       Outline Features and Functionality: Don't overwhelm users with excessive features. Start with a core set of functionalities that deliver the core value proposition and consider adding more based on user feedback in later versions.

2. Embrace User-Centric Design:

       Prioritize User Experience (UX): Your app's usability is paramount. Focus on intuitive navigation, clear user flows, and a visually appealing interface that aligns with Material Design principles.

       Gather User Feedback: Get real people involved early and often. Conduct user testing throughout the development process to identify usability issues and ensure your app caters to user needs.

3. Plan for Development and Beyond:

       Choose the Right Development Partner: It is crucial to select a reputable and experienced Android app development company. Look for a team with a proven track record, expertise in your industry, and a collaborative approach.

       Consider Development Methodology: Agile development methodologies allow for flexibility and faster iterations based on user feedback. Discuss this approach with your development partner to see if it aligns with your project needs.

       Factor in Ongoing Maintenance: The mobile app landscape is constantly evolving. Plan for ongoing maintenance costs to ensure your app receives regular updates, bug fixes, and security patches to keep it functioning optimally.

4. App Store Optimization (ASO):

       Optimize App Title and Description: Use relevant keywords that users might search for to improve your app's discoverability in the Play Store. Craft a compelling description that highlights the app's benefits and value proposition.

       High-Quality Screenshots and App Icon: First impressions matter! Invest in professional app screenshots and an eye-catching icon that accurately represents your app and entices users to download it.

5. Pre-Launch Marketing and User Acquisition:

       Create a Buzz: Generate pre-launch excitement by building a website or landing page. Utilize social media platforms to connect with your target audience and provide updates about your app's development.

       Develop a Marketing Strategy: Plan your post-launch marketing strategy. Consider influencer marketing, paid advertising campaigns, or public relations efforts to reach your target users and drive downloads.

Bonus Tip: Focus on Data-Driven Decisions

Throughout the development and post-launch phases, use analytics tools to track user behavior and app performance. Analyze the data to identify areas for improvement, optimize features based on user engagement, and make data-driven decisions that ensure your app's long-term success.

How Blockchain is Transforming Android App Development

With the rise of blockchain technology, Android app development is poised for a significant transformation. This innovative technology promises to revolutionize everything from data security to user trust, paving the way for a new generation of secure and transparent mobile experiences.

What is Blockchain and How Does it Work?

Imagine a public ledger, a digital record of transactions, accessible to everyone but tamper-proof. That's what blockchain is. Transactions are grouped into blocks, which are then cryptographically linked together in a chain, creating an immutable record. This distributed ledger technology eliminates the need for a central authority, fostering trust and transparency within a network.

The Impact on Android Apps

Here's how blockchain technology is impacting Android app development:

       Enhanced Security: Blockchain's core strength lies in its security. Data stored on the blockchain is virtually impossible to alter or hack, making it ideal for Android apps that handle sensitive information like financial transactions or personal data.

       Decentralization and Trust: By removing the need for a central authority, blockchain empowers users by giving them control of their data. This fosters trust within Android apps, particularly those that involve peer-to-peer transactions or rely on user-generated content.

       Transparency and Traceability: Every transaction on a blockchain is permanently recorded and viewable by authorized participants. This level of openness offers numerous benefits for Android apps, such as ensuring the authenticity of products in a supply chain or tracking the movement of goods in logistics applications.

       New Revenue Models: Blockchain opens doors to innovative revenue models for Android apps. Cryptocurrencies and non-fungible tokens (NFTs) can be integrated into apps, creating new in-app purchase opportunities and fostering a digital economy within the app.

Examples of Blockchain-powered Android Apps

       Secure Wallets: Several Android apps already leverage blockchain technology to provide secure storage and management of cryptocurrencies.

       Decentralized marketplaces: Blockchain empowers peer-to-peer transactions, enabling Android apps to facilitate secure and transparent buying and selling of goods or services without an intermediary.

       Supply Chain Management: Tracking the movement of goods through a supply chain becomes more efficient and transparent with blockchain, leading to Android apps that streamline logistics processes.

       Voting Apps: Blockchain's tamper-proof nature can be harnessed to create secure and verifiable voting applications for Android devices.

The Final Word

By capitalizing on the information provided in this comprehensive guide, you're well-equipped to make an informed decision and select the ideal partner to bring your mobile vision to life.

Remember, the best Android app development company for you depends on your specific project needs and budget. After deep analysis, we found that TechnBrains is the best company for your custom Android app needs. Consider the factors outlined earlier to narrow your choices and prioritize companies with experience in your industry and a development methodology that aligns with your project requirements.

Feel free to reach out to potential partners and discuss your project in detail. Clear communication and a collaborative approach are crucial for success. By following these steps, you'll be well on your way to developing a winning Android app that thrives in the Play Store and exceeds your expectations.

Are you ready to explore the possibilities of blockchain technology in your next Android app? Talk to a qualified Android app development company like TechnBrains to discuss how you can leverage this innovative technology to create a secure, trustworthy, and future-proof mobile experience for your users.


Related Articles

Hire Android Developer from Mindinventory 15$/Hr

Hire Android Developer from Mindinventory 15$/HrSolitary Platform for Numerous Devices.Top Notch Android Application and Android SDK Solutions.Usability Testing to Guarantee Results Android application development has ideal ...

How Important It Is To Hire A Skilled Developer For Android Apps Development

Android apps development is now becoming a basic necessity for all individuals. Smart phones have revolutionized the way people used to perceive a mobile phone. Currently, smart phones come packed with a number of features. Android applications have revolutionized the market for smart phone app...

Google Android app development outpacing Apple iOS and Windows Phone

The pace of development in the Google ecosystem means that Apple is fast losing it's first-mover advantage in mobile, with sales of Android apps in the Google Play store booming in the fourth quarter of 2012, while the growth in sales of Apple apps has slowed.According to Google, app sales doubled i...

Hire Android Application Developers and Get Your Customized Application Developed

It is all about customization these days. Companies which provide highly customized, bespoke, tailor-made solutions are the companies which are thriving and churning out high profits. Other companies which sell standardized solutions are the ones which are just ‘surviving’. Believing that each a...

How Android Apps Development Is Driving Businesses Towards Success

Smart phones based on android and smart phone applications are increasing by the minute. Due to the soaring number of applications and creative games, utilities and business applications being introduced on a daily basis, there is an increased demand for smart phone apps developers. The apps mar...

Android application for Arthritis treatment

Have you ever heard of a mobile application treatment for Arthritis? It seems you have not heard of this existence/development. This unusual yet useful idea is the brainchild on a Mumbai-based physician, Dr. Shashank Akrekar.Akrekar has developed an Android application for rheumatoid patients, which...